Transaction 90d42dd81ac86e0764e66d359d50eb8ac23a1e14b110194851d2a4703c1263b8
1 Input
1 Output
-
90d42dd81ac86e0764e66d359d50eb8ac23a1e14b110194851d2a4703c1263b8:0
- value
- 129445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d342a66bdbb46925b8a562e651af82f1bf6c1fe OP_EQUAL
- address
- 3MrdkUCgMRaN2n3QFG9kR8NT9CNNWhrwqq